St. Anselm of Canterbury (1033-1109) was an Italian Benedictine monk, abbot, and theologian. He was the archbishop of Canterbury from 1093 to 1109 and was declared a saint soon after his death. Later, in 1720, he was pronounced a doctor of the church. These meditations were written before St. Anselm became Archbishop of Canterbury. They are personal devotional reflections with deep theological underpinnings. They are intended to draw the listener closer to God and motivate them to achieve a higher spiritual state.
